Moving to Aruba: permission and practical setup
Paid employment is tied to DIMAS residence permission, the labour-market process and the specified employer and role. Family, study and investor residents use separate applications and must not infer unrestricted work rights.

Match DIMAS permission to the exact role
DIMAS says a paid-employment applicant needs the work and residence process, with DPL labour-market review, and permission is linked to the approved employer and position. A short project, family reunion or investor case uses a different route and does not imply general labour access.
| Plan | Route | Important distinction |
|---|---|---|
| Local employment | Paid Employment Work and Residence Permit | DPL review and DIMAS permission |
| Defined short project | Short-term Project Permit | Project-specific approval |
| Family move | Family Reunification / Family Formation Residence | Relationship and sponsor evidence |
| Investor or shareholder | Investor and Shareholder Residence | Business and residence evidence |
Use the current DIMAS checklist for each applicant
Prepare passports, birth and relationship records, police and medical evidence, employer or business documents and proof of support. Confirm apostille or legalisation and accepted language. Do not start work while an application is pending.
Complete civil registration and choose housing carefully
Follow DIMAS and Censo instructions for the residence document and population record. Inspect cooling costs, water, electricity, internet, storm and flood exposure, inventory and lease terms; verify that the address is accepted for government and bank records.
Connect tax, social insurance and AZV eligibility
Ask the employer to document tax and social-insurance registration and reconcile the first payroll record. Determine AZV health-insurance enrolment from lawful residence and registration rather than from the job offer alone. Banks make separate identity, address and source-of-funds checks.
Coordinate dependants, healthcare and school language
Confirm every dependant’s DIMAS and Censo status and whether a partner needs separate work permission. Verify AZV or private cover before cancelling interim insurance. Ask the school about placement, language, immigration, vaccination and prior-school documents.
Plan a resident licence and controlled imports
Ask the driver-licensing authority how the issuing licence is treated before driving. Obtain Customs decisions before shipping goods or a vehicle and Veterinary Service import permission before a pet travels; island freight and storage make rejected cargo costly.
